
java 如何查看日志
用户关注问题
如何在Java项目中快速定位日志文件位置?
我在运行Java程序时想查看生成的日志,可是找不到日志文件存放在哪里,应该如何确定日志文件的位置?
确定Java项目日志文件的存放路径
日志文件的位置通常是在项目的配置文件中指定的,例如在log4j.properties、logback.xml等日志框架配置文件中,可以找到日志文件的路径设置。也可以查看启动参数中是否有定义日志路径,或者查看代码中日志输出相关的配置。
Java程序如何设置日志级别以便更有效地查看日志信息?
我觉得程序输出的日志信息太多或者太少,怎样调整日志的详细程度,方便我查看需要的日志内容?
调整Java日志的级别设置方法
Java日志框架通常支持多种日志级别,如ERROR、WARN、INFO、DEBUG和TRACE。通过修改日志配置文件中的日志级别,可以控制日志的输出量。比如设置为DEBUG可以看到详细的调试信息,设置为ERROR则只显示错误信息。
如何在Java中实现实时查看日志输出?
我希望在程序运行时能够实时看到日志输出内容,避免等程序结束后才查看日志文件,应该怎么做?
实现Java日志实时查看的方式
可以采用日志框架自带的控制台输出功能,让日志直接输出到控制台窗口,从而实时查看日志内容。另外,可以使用IDE的控制台窗口或外部工具如tail命令对日志文件进行实时监控。